로봇 휠체어 세계 시장은 2030년까지 14억 달러에 달할 전망

2024년에 5억 5,140만 달러로 추정되는 로봇 휠체어 세계 시장은 2024년부터 2030년까지 CAGR 16.1%로 성장하고, 2030년에는 14억 달러에 달할 것으로 예측됩니다. 이 보고서에서 분석한 부문 중 하나인 주거용 용도는 CAGR 15.9%를 기록하며 분석기간 종료시에는 11억 달러에 달할 것으로 예측됩니다. 상업용 용도 부문의 성장률은 분석기간 동안 CAGR 17.2%로 추정됩니다.

미국 시장은 1억 4,680만 달러로 추정, 중국은 CAGR 15.1%로 성장 예측

미국의 로봇 휠체어 시장은 2024년에 1억 4,680만 달러로 추정됩니다. 세계 2위 경제 대국인 중국은 분석기간인 2024-2030년 CAGR 15.1%로 추정되며, 2030년에는 예측 시장 규모 2억 660만 달러에 달할 것으로 예측됩니다. 기타 주목할 만한 지역별 시장으로는 일본과 캐나다가 있고, 분석기간 동안 CAGR은 각각 14.8%와 13.8%로 예측됩니다. 유럽에서는 독일이 CAGR 11.8%로 성장할 것으로 예측됩니다.

로봇 휠체어 - 주요 동향과 촉진요인

로봇 휠체어는 최신 로봇공학과 전통적인 전동 휠체어를 결합하여 자율적으로 이동하고 장애물을 감지하고 사용자의 제어와 안전을 향상시키는 장치를 만들어 이동 보조기구의 획기적인 발전을 나타냅니다. 이 휠체어는 센서, 인공지능, 고급 제어 메커니즘을 포함한 첨단 시스템을 갖추고 있어 사용자 경험을 크게 향상시킵니다. 로봇 휠체어의 주요 구성요소는 환경 인식 및 탐색, 모션 제어 및 인간-기계 인터페이스입니다.

고급 모빌리티 솔루션에 대한 수요가 증가하는 배경에는 고령자, 사고 피해자, 장애인들 사이에서 부동성 문제가 만연해 있기 때문입니다. 전 세계 인구의 고령화와 함께 마비, 뇌졸중, 신경퇴행성 질환, 비만 등의 증상이 보편화되면서 로봇 휠체어와 같은 혁신적인 이동성 보조기구의 개발이 필요하게 되었습니다. 헬스케어 부문도 이러한 사람들의 삶의 질을 개선하기 위해 많은 투자를 하고 있으며, 이는 연구개발에 대한 막대한 투자로 이어지고 있습니다. 정부 및 민간 단체들은 보다 진보되고 신뢰할 수 있는 이동성 장치 개발에 자금을 지원하고 있으며, 이동성 지원 강화에 대한 요구가 증가하고 있음을 인식하고 있습니다. 또한, 신흥국의 가처분 소득이 증가함에 따라 이러한 첨단 솔루션에 대한 접근성이 높아지면서 시장 성장에 더욱 박차를 가하고 있습니다. 로봇공학과 인공지능의 지속적인 기술 발전도 매우 중요하며, 다양한 사용자 요구에 더 잘 대응할 수 있는 더 스마트하고 자율적인 휠체어를 만들 수 있게 해줍니다. 연구개발에 대한 집중적인 노력과 로봇 산업계의 관심 증가는 이 시장의 지속적인 혁신과 확장을 촉진할 것이며, 로봇 휠체어는 현대 모빌리티 솔루션의 필수적인 부분으로 자리 잡을 것으로 예상됩니다.

로봇 휠체어 시장의 미래를 좌우할 몇 가지 주목할 만한 트렌드가 있습니다. 그 중 하나는 인공지능(AI), 머신러닝(ML), 사물인터넷(IoT)과 같은 첨단 기술이 로봇 휠체어에 통합되고 있다는 점입니다. 이러한 기술은 휠체어의 기능과 자율성을 크게 향상시켜 음성 제어, 자율주행 내비게이션, 실시간 건강 모니터링 등의 기능을 가능하게 합니다. 또 다른 추세는 병원, 공항, 요양원 등 상업적 환경에서 로봇 휠체어의 채택이 증가하고 있다는 점입니다. 이러한 환경은 로봇 휠체어의 첨단 기능을 통해 환자, 방문객, 거주자에게 효율적이고 신뢰할 수 있는 이동성 솔루션을 제공하고 있습니다. 또한, 사용자 개개인의 필요에 따라 맞춤형 휠체어 솔루션 개발에도 큰 관심이 쏠리고 있습니다. 뇌파 제어 및 로봇 팔과 같은 기술 혁신은 심각한 이동 장애를 가진 사용자에게 더 많은 자율성과 지원을 약속합니다. 이러한 발전은 시장에 혁명을 불러일으킬 것으로 예상되며, 사용자에게 전례 없는 수준의 제어와 독립성을 제공할 것으로 기대됩니다. 로봇 휠체어와 통합된 스마트 가젯 및 웨어러블 기기의 출현은 제조업체에 새로운 기회를 제공합니다. 이러한 장치는 건강 모니터링 및 개인화 된 지원과 같은 추가 기능을 제공하여 사용자 경험을 향상시킬 수 있습니다.

Global Robotic Wheelchairs Market to Reach US$1.4 Billion by 2030

The global market for Robotic Wheelchairs estimated at US$551.4 Million in the year 2024, is expected to reach US$1.4 Billion by 2030, growing at a CAGR of 16.1% over the analysis period 2024-2030. Residential Application, one of the segments analyzed in the report, is expected to record a 15.9% CAGR and reach US$1.1 Billion by the end of the analysis period. Growth in the Commercial Application segment is estimated at 17.2% CAGR over the analysis period.

The U.S. Market is Estimated at US$146.8 Million While China is Forecast to Grow at 15.1% CAGR

The Robotic Wheelchairs market in the U.S. is estimated at US$146.8 Million in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$206.6 Million by the year 2030 trailing a CAGR of 15.1%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 14.8% and 13.8%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 11.8% CAGR.

Robotic Wheelchairs - Key Trends and Drivers

Robotic wheelchairs represent a remarkable advancement in mobility aids, combining the latest in robotics with traditional electric wheelchairs to create devices that can navigate autonomously, detect obstacles, and provide improved control and safety for users. These wheelchairs are equipped with advanced systems, including sensors, artificial intelligence, and sophisticated control mechanisms, enhancing user experience significantly. The main components of a robotic wheelchair are environmental awareness and navigation, motion control, and human-machine interfaces.

The increasing demand for advanced mobility solutions is driven by the rising prevalence of immobility issues among the elderly, accident victims, and individuals with disabilities. As the global population ages, conditions like paralysis, strokes, neurodegenerative disorders, and obesity are becoming more common, necessitating the development of innovative mobility aids such as robotic wheelchairs. The healthcare sector is also investing heavily in improving the quality of life for these individuals, leading to substantial investments in research and development. Governments and private organizations are funding the creation of more sophisticated and reliable mobility devices, recognizing the growing need for enhanced mobility assistance. Additionally, the rise in disposable incomes in emerging economies has made these advanced solutions more accessible, further driving market growth. Continuous technological advancements in robotics and artificial intelligence are also pivotal, enabling the creation of smarter, more autonomous wheelchairs that better meet diverse user needs. The focus on research and development, coupled with growing interest from the robotics industry, is expected to drive continuous innovation and expansion in this market, making robotic wheelchairs an indispensable part of modern mobility solutions.

Several noteworthy trends are shaping the future of the robotic wheelchair market. One major trend is the integration of advanced technologies such as artificial intelligence (AI), machine learning (ML), and the Internet of Things (IoT) into robotic wheelchairs. These technologies greatly enhance the functionality and autonomy of the wheelchairs, enabling features like voice control, autonomous navigation, and real-time health monitoring. Another trend is the increasing adoption of robotic wheelchairs in commercial settings like hospitals, airports, and care homes. These environments benefit from the advanced capabilities of robotic wheelchairs, offering efficient and reliable mobility solutions for patients, visitors, and residents. Additionally, there is a significant focus on developing more personalized and customizable wheelchair solutions to meet individual users' specific needs. Innovations like brain wave control and robotic arms promise even greater autonomy and support for users with severe mobility impairments. These advancements are expected to revolutionize the market, providing users with unprecedented control and independence levels. The emergence of smart gadgets and wearable devices integrated with robotic wheelchairs also creates new opportunities for manufacturers. These devices can enhance the user experience by offering additional functionalities like health monitoring and personalized assistance.
